Homeowners: The Office

The office has become one of the most used rooms in our house and just so happened to be one of the first places I tackled once we moved in. Since J is working from home and I'm in school, we both knew we needed to have specific places to work instead of just spreading out on the kitchen table or somewhere else in the house. 

After a paint transformation from pastel-pink with sparkle to a soothing sage green plus the addition of two new desks and some decor we already had, here's a peak into where we've been spending a lot of time lately. 

We decided to take the closet doors off and put my desk snuggled into the space. It worked out perfect because there's an overhead light inside all our closets and it helps the room not seem too crowded with two big desks.

This is the usual state of my desk... covered with Basis of Disease books or lab manuals, tons of notes and colored pens and of course, coffee! I reused the frame that held our table-settings at the wedding to hold some of my favorite pictures from that day. As much as I hate how much time I spend sitting here, at least I've got my own little set-up to make me smile.

We bought two bookcases from Target that now hold both "for fun" books as well as all my textbooks. Our diplomas are finally hung and I made a few prints of encouragement to lighten things up. I have to say my current favorite shelf is the one that holds all my new med school equipment, purple stethoscope and all!

The office window faces to the front of the house and lets us know who's coming and going throughout the day/evening. And there are always signs of Ollie in the form of dog hair, toys and sometimes even his silly self making the office that much better.

Now if only I wasn't spending hours upon hours up here ;-)
